Lawnwood Hospital: Does It Have A Nicu?

is there a nicu at lawnwood hospital

HCA Florida Lawnwood Hospital is a 497-bed acute-care hospital located in Fort Pierce, Florida, that offers a wide range of healthcare services, including a Level III neonatal intensive care unit (NICU). The NICU at Lawnwood Hospital is the only Level III NICU on the Treasure Coast and is equipped to provide specialized care for newborn infants with varying degrees of complexity and risk. It is staffed by highly trained clinicians, including board-certified neonatologists, neonatal nurses, and neonatal respiratory therapists, who work together to ensure that each baby receives individualized attention and support. Lawnwood Hospital's NICU is committed to providing advanced healthcare services with a compassionate, patient-focused approach, making it a safe and reliable place for premature or sick newborns.

Lawnwood Hospital's NICU is ranked Level III

HCA Florida Lawnwood Hospital is a 497-bed acute-care hospital that offers a wide range of healthcare services to meet the needs of Florida's Treasure Coast community. Among its many specialties is a Level III neonatal intensive care unit (NICU).

The NICU at Lawnwood Hospital is a 20-bed unit staffed by highly trained, compassionate clinicians, including board-certified neonatologists, nationally certified neonatal nurse practitioners, and physician assistants. The team works together to ensure that each newborn receives individualized attention and support, with 24-hour coverage and multiple centralised nurse stations for constant monitoring.

As a Level III NICU, Lawnwood Hospital is equipped to handle newborn infants with widely differing degrees of complexity and risk. They can care for neonates from 22 weeks of gestation through full term, with a neonatal transport team available 24/7 to bring critically ill infants from other regional hospitals.

The hospital also offers a full range of inpatient and outpatient surgical services, a Heart Institute, a Level II Trauma Center, a Stroke Center, and a Pediatric Emergency Care Center. The NICU is led by board-certified neonatologists

HCA Florida Lawnwood Hospital is a 497-bed acute-care hospital that provides healthcare services to Florida's Treasure Coast community. The hospital is home to a Level III NICU, which is led by board-certified neonatologists.

Neonatologists are paediatricians who have specialised in treating newborns, particularly those that are born prematurely or with a disease or birth defect. The board-certified neonatologists at Lawnwood Hospital are supported by a team of highly trained, compassionate clinicians, including nationally certified neonatal nurse practitioners and physician assistants. Together, they provide 24-hour coverage to ensure that each baby receives the individualised attention and support they need.

The Level III NICU at Lawnwood Hospital is the only one of its kind on the Treasure Coast. It is equipped to provide care to newborn infants with widely differing degrees of complexity and risk. The unit has 20 beds and is staffed by around 60 people, including multiple centralised nurse stations to monitor infants.

In addition to the expertise of its staff, the NICU combines advanced technology to provide specialised care for premature and sick newborns. This includes a neonatal intensive care transport team that is available 24/7 to move critically ill infants to the NICU from other regional hospitals.

Frequently asked questions

Yes, HCA Florida Lawnwood Hospital has a Level III NICU.

Level III NICUs are differentiated by their ability to provide care to newborn infants with widely differing degrees of complexity and risk. They are ranked from level one to level four, with four being the highest certification.

The NICU team at Lawnwood Hospital is led by board-certified neonatologists and includes neonatal nurses, neonatal respiratory therapists, and neonatal nurse practitioners.
